40 yard dumpster dimensions

Renting a 40 yard dumpster can get you a container that holds about 40 cubic yards of waste. Dumpster sizes and dimensions aren't totally conventional from company to company, but common measurements for a 40 yard container are 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 8 feet high. This is the largest size that a lot of dumpster firms commonly rent, so it's perfect for large residential projects as well as for commercial and industrial use.

A 40 yard container will carry between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ris. Examples of the total amount of waste and debris that could fit in this container comprise:

  • Waste from a window or siding replacement for a big house
  • A commercial roof tear off A cleanout from a commercial or office building
  • New construction or a major add-on to a large house
  • Large amounts of demolition debris, paper, cardboard and junk

Receiving the Best Price on Your Dumpster Rental in Norwood

Dumpster leases are one of the most affordable ways to remove waste and debris from a house or commercial property. Still, it's important for you to contemplate your options to ensure you get the best price possible on your price of dumpster in Norwood.

Requesting companies for price quotes is among the simplest methods to ensure you get a great deal. After speaking to a number of companies, you can compare the quotes to decide which one meets your needs at the bottom price. When getting quotes, make sure that the companies contain all the services you will need. Some companies charge extra for services like drop off and pick up. They might also charge higher rates for removing particular kinds of materials. By having them contain all the fees in your estimate, you can compare the prices accurately instead of getting mislead by a rental company that conceals additional costs.

What Types of Debris Can I Put Into a Dumpster?

It's possible for you to set most sorts of debris into a price of dumpster in Norwood. There are, however,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ot place chemicals into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ronic Equipment and batteries are also prohibited. If something poses an environmental hazard, you likely cannot put it in a dumpster. Get in touch with your rental business if you are uncertain.

That makes most kinds of debris that you can put in the dumpster, contain dr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any type of debris left from a building job can go in the dumpster.

Specific kinds of satisfactory debris, however, may require additional fees. If you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you need to request the rental business whether you are required to pay an additional f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, depending on the item.


What if I have to keep a dumpster longer than seven days?

Most price of dumpster businesses in Norwood typically rent containers for a regular speed for 7 days, although most one time customers end up keeping their container an average of three and a half days. When you call to allow the container, conversation with the customer support representative about the length of time you believe you will need.

If it turns out that your project takes longer than you expected, simply call the dumpster company to describe. Most businesses will charge you on a per-day basis after your first seven days. It's vital that you convey this added need as soon as you understand you have it since most dumpster companies have a restricted number of bins that will already be reserved. Most businesses will work together with you to adapt your extra rental time. In case you believe you will want the dumpster for an extra week or more, be sure to mention that; rates may change based on a longer time period.

What Size Dumpster Do I Need for a Roofing Project?

Choosing a dumpster size necessitates some educated guesswork. It's often difficult for people to gauge the sizes that they need for roofing jobs because, realistically, they do not know how much stuff their roofs feature.

There are, nevertheless, some basic guidelines you'll be able to follow to make an excellent alternative. If you're removing a commercial roof, then you will probably need a dumpster that gives you at least 40 square yards.

If you're working on residential roofing job, then you can ordinarily rely on a smaller size. You can generally exp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will likely need a 20-yard dumpster.

A lot of people order one size larger than they think their endeavors will require since they would like to prevent the additional expense and hassle of replacing complete dumpsters that weren't large enough.


30 yard dumpster measurements in Norwood

If you rent a 30 yard dumpster, you will be receiving a container that can carry 30 cubic yards of waste or debris. Your 30 yard container will measure about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 6 feet high. These amounts could vary somewhat depending on the price of dumpster business in Norwood you select. A 30 yard dumpster will carry between 9 and 15 pickup truck loads of waste, therefore it's a good option for whole-house residential cleanouts as well as commercial cleaning jobs.

Examples of jobs that would create enough waste for a 30 yard container include:

  • A leading house add-on
  • Construction of a brand new house
  • A garage demolition
  • Whole-house window or siding replacement (for a small- to medium-size house)

The weight allowance for a 30 yard dumpster will range from 2 to 8 tons (4,000 to 16,000 pounds). Make sure you do not exceed this weight limitation or you could face overage charges.
